The General Consul of France Visited Beit Sahour
The Mayor gave a brief about the situation and difficulties that are facing the Palestinians in general and the Municipalities in particular due to the continued siege. The mayor then talked about the solid and good relations that connects Beit Sahour Municipality with other French Municipalities and stressed out the fact that such connections are very important for the work of the municipality. The delegation then took a tour in the city of Beit Sahour where they visited the Bypass road where they saw with their own eyes the land that belonged to the Palestinians and were confiscated by the Israelis. Later they visited the evacuated camp site were the municipality is planning to establish a public park and finally they visited the Industrial Zone.
At the end of the visit, a group of young musicians from the Edward Saed Conservatory of Music played two pieces of Arabic music; their performance was very much liked by the audience. As part of the working program for the year 2007 between the Municipality of Grenoble – France and the Municipality of Beit Sahour- Palestine, this group was invited by the city of Grenoble - France to participate in a Youth Musicians Camp along with other young musicians from nine different cities in the world. Finally, the French consul Mr. Remy thanked the Mayor and council members for the friendly welcome and assured that the French people will always support the Palestinians and their cause. |
